According to a source at the Westchester County medical … graphic geogebraHenry Earl Sinks (January 1, 1940 – May 13, 2024), known professionally as Earl Sinks, was an American singer-songwriter and actor, known by many pseudonyms. He led a prolific musical and acting career from the 1950s to the 1990s before retiring. He was best known for his long music career, including his brief tenure as … See more Sinks was performing with Bob Wills at age 12 before doing his first recordings in 1958 at Norman Petty Studios as a solo artist.
